Is online notarization recognized in Oklahoma?
Permanent RON law in effect. Accepts out-of-state RON notarizations. No special restrictions on Texas RON notaries serving Oklahoma signers. Robin performs every notarization from Texas under Texas law; acceptance of a specific document is determined by the receiving party, and she’ll help you confirm any requirements first.
How is my Enid online notarization kept secure?
Before anything is signed, your photo ID is checked and you answer knowledge-based questions; the Enid session is then encrypted, recorded, and securely kept for 5 years exactly as Texas law requires.
